Dodgeville, WI (Population 5,094)
The City of Dodgeville is seeking its first City Administrator to lead a talented leadership team and support the Mayor and City Council in building on the community’s success. Located in southwestern Wisconsin, Dodgeville is a historic and growing full-service community known as “At the Heart of it All” and valued for its high quality of life and municipal services.
Key priorities include establishing the new position; improving internal recordkeeping and operational processes; updating the City’s Comprehensive and CORP plans; developing a long-range capital improvements plan (CIP); sustaining current economic development efforts; developing enhanced community engagement and communications; and maintaining strong first responder services.
Candidates should have experience in municipal finance, budgeting, debt financing/TIF, capital planning, human resources, economic development, and organizational leadership.
